The create volume permissions fall into the following categories:
allgroup. All AWS accounts have create volume permissions for these snapshots.
The list of snapshots returned can be modified by specifying snapshot IDs, snapshot owners, or AWS accounts with create volume permissions. If no options are specified, Amazon EC2 returns all snapshots for which you have create volume permissions.
If you specify one or more snapshot IDs, only snapshots that have the specified IDs are returned. If you specify an invalid snapshot ID, an error is returned. If you specify a snapshot ID for which you do not have access, it is not included in the returned results.
If you specify one or more snapshot owners, only snapshots from the specified owners
and for which you have access are returned. The results can include the AWS account
IDs of the specified owners,
amazon for snapshots owned by Amazon, or
self for snapshots that you own.
If you specify a list of restorable users, only snapshots with create snapshot permissions
for those users are returned. You can specify AWS account IDs (if you own the snapshots),
self for snapshots for which you own or have explicit permissions, or
all for public snapshots.
If you are describing a long list of snapshots, you can paginate the output to make
the list more manageable. The
MaxResults parameter sets the maximum number
of results returned in a single page. If the list of results exceeds your
value, then that number of results is returned along with a
value that can be passed to a subsequent
DescribeSnapshots request to
retrieve the remaining results.
For more information about EBS snapshots, see Amazon EBS Snapshots in the Amazon Elastic Compute Cloud User Guide.
Version: (assembly version)
public abstract DescribeSnapshotsResponse DescribeSnapshots( DescribeSnapshotsRequest request )
Container for the necessary parameters to execute the DescribeSnapshots service method.
Supported in: 4.5, 4.0, 3.5